About #CBE6EF Color Code

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 195°, a saturation of 53%, and a lightness of 87%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 195°, a saturation of 15%, and a value of 94%.

  • HEX: #CBE6EF
  • RGB: rgb(203, 230, 239)
  • HSL: hsl(195, 53%, 87%)
  • HSV: hsv(195, 15%, 94%)
  • CMYK: 15.00% cyan, 4.00% magenta, 0.00% yellow, 6.00% black
  • XYZ: 68.86, 75.25, 70.16
  • Yxy: 75.25, 0.3214, 0.3512
  • Hunter Lab: 89.51, -7.85, -7.56
  • CIE-Lab: 89.51, -7.85, -7.56

In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 68.86, Y: 75.25, Z: 70.16.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 75.25, x: 0.3214, and y: 0.3512.

In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 89.51, a: -7.85, and b: -7.56.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 89.51, a: -7.85, and b: -7.56.
